- After a go at Rock and Roll in the mid-eighties, Chris Laine began his career in Film and Television as a Camera Assistant in NYC. He went to Vienna, Austria in 1993, where he shot 2nd Unit on a feature. From there he began a 4 year stint, lensing commercials, industrials, features and shorts, as well as overseeing the Camera and Lighting Department of one of Austria's first private television networks, VTV. Chris returned to the U.S. in 1997 and landed work as a Gaffer in Los Angeles under the direction of such notables as Greg Gardiner. But it was an opportunity to shoot documentaries where Chris found his groove again. He has built an extensive resume with such networks as VH1, Discovery, History Channel, A&E and CourtTV, while still continuing to work in Europe. Drawing from his background in Music, Chris relishes the collaborative spirit of Filmmaking-- which he likens to "jamming".- IMDb Mini Biography By: cnl
